What is laryngopharyngeal reflux?
When stomach acid refluxes into the esophagus, it's called gastroesophageal reflux. However, when stomach acid refluxes into the throat, meaning stomach contents (refluxate) flow back to the esophagus into the throat and vocal cords, irritating the tissues around the throat and causing discomfort or inflammation, it's called laryngopharyngeal reflux. However, the throat and vocal cords are far more sensitive to stomach acid than the esophagus, so even small amounts of stomach acid can cause inflammation and damage, but not necessarily a burning sensation. This means many people are unaware they have laryngopharyngeal reflux because symptoms like hoarseness, chronic cough, or a feeling of something stuck in the throat are similar to those of other illnesses such as allergies or colds.
